Did you heed the warning about putting your phone in Airplane mode before 
running anySIM on 1.1.2?

Also, it's been noted elsewhere that anySIM 1.2 isn't intended to be run under 
firmware 1.1.2, so you may need 
to upgrade to 1.1.2, then downgrade back to 1.0.2, install and run anySIM under 
1.0.2, then upgrade to 1.1.2 
again.

Yes, things are a bit of a mess with anySIM.  Have a read through the 
iPhone-Elite page for details.

Okay, making progress.  My mistake before was I used Anysim 1.1 not 1.2.1u when 
I was in iPhone v 1.0.2.

This was wiped out when I updated, so I killed it using Anysim in 1.1.2 (didn't 
know about using airplane 
mode.)

So I went back to 1.0.2, used the new Anysim, went back up to 1.1.2 and it 
works!

Only problem is that the anything I do in the phone section crashes.  Push any 
number or the RECENT button 
and it crashes back to home.  Can't dial out, can't get incoming, though it 
does show I have a missed call 
afterwards.  I see this in home, there is a 1 on the phone icon.

All fixed now.  Happily using 1.1.2 in Australia.  

The answer is to use INSTALLER (hard to find) to install iWorld (easy to find) 
and
this fixes the dialer problem.
